The Accept Offer Sample in Miami-Dade is a model letter designed for applicants to formally accept a job offer. This customizable document allows users to confirm the initial offer details, including job position, responsibilities, and salary agreements. Key features include space for personal information, a clear and professional tone, and the option to customize departmental roles and salary figures. Filling out the form involves simply inserting relevant details where indicated, ensuring clarity and precision. This form serves multiple legal and business professionals including attorneys, partners, owners, associates, paralegals, and legal assistants by providing a structured format for communication between employer and employee. It ensures that both parties are on the same page regarding expectations and terms of employment, which can be critical in preventing future disputes. Users can easily adapt this template to match specific circumstances and requirements of their hiring process, making it a versatile tool in job acceptance scenarios.
